About Resolutions Healthcare – Gun Barrel City

Resolutions Healthcare's Gun Barrel City facility, located in Gun Barrel City, Texas, offers an intensive outpatient program (IOP) providing specialized treatment for individuals struggling with substance use disorders and co-occurring mental health issues. The center is deeply committed to a trauma-informed care approach, acknowledging the critical link between past traumas and the development of addiction, ensuring comprehensive and empathetic support for each client.

Clients engage in a structured program that includes a rich array of therapeutic modalities. These encompass individual and group therapy,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), Eye Movement Therapy (EMDR), and Twelve Step Facilitation. This comprehensive framework allows clients to receive intensive treatment while maintaining their daily responsibilities, making it an ideal choice for those unable to commit to residential care.

Situated in Gun Barrel City, the center offers a supportive and serene environment conducive to healing and personal growth. Its proximity to Cedar Creek Lake provides a peaceful backdrop that enhances the recovery experience, allowing clients to benefit from tranquil surroundings during therapeutic activities. Resolutions Healthcare prioritizes individualized care, crafting treatment plans tailored to each client's unique needs and circumstances, thereby equipping them with robust tools for long-term recovery.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the primary focus of Resolutions Healthcare - Gun Barrel City?

The facility focuses on intensive outpatient treatment for substance use disorders and co-occurring mental health issues, with a trauma-informed approach.

What levels of care are offered?

Resolutions Healthcare - Gun Barrel City provides an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P).

What therapies are available at this facility?

Therapies include 1-on-1 Counseling, Trauma-Specific Therapy,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Eye Movement Therapy (EMDR), Twelve Step Facilitation, Dialectical Behavior Therapy, and Group Therapy.

What types of addictions are treated here?

The facility specializes in treating alcohol and drug addiction.

Does Resolutions Healthcare - Gun Barrel City accept insurance?

Yes, Resolutions Healthcare accepts most insurances.
